Botanical name:
Plantago spp.
A number of species are used:
  1. P. majus, Greater Plantain (Main source)
  2. P. lanceolata, Ribwort Plantain (preferred for Lung conditions)
  3. P. coronopus, Buck's-Horn Plantain
  4. P. media is Hoary Plantain.
  5. P. asciatica and others are used in India and China.
  6. P. majus and P. depressa are reportedly used in Tibet.

Parts used:
Herb, Juice; sometimes the root

Temperature & Taste:
Cool, dry. Slightly Bitter and Sweet
cleanses, thickens

Classifications:
2G. CLEANSING.    2N. REPELLENTS.    2O. ASTRINGENTS.    2T. GLUTINATE.    2Z. CICATRIZING
3B. FEBRIFUGE & ANTIPYRETIC.    3K. EXPECTORANT.    3L. ANTI-TUSSIVE.    3M. ARTHRITICS
4e. STOMACHIC

Uses:
1. Clears Heat and Phlegm, Stops Cough (Herb, Seed; TCM, West):
-heat-type coughs with thick yellow phlegm, dry cough

2. Clears Heat and Toxins, Reduces Swelling, Eases Pain (Herb, Seed; TCM, West):
-all sorts of Fevers

3. Clears Heat, Stops Bleeding:
-spitting of blood, bloody Urine, and excessive Menstruation (TCM, West)

4. Clears Heat and Damp, Promotes Urine (Herb, Seed; TCM, West):
-Edema, Cystitis, Incontinence, Hematuria

5. Externally:
-externally, applied to fresh Wounds and Ulcers
-
poultice of the leaves is good for heat-type pain and inflammation; Dermatitis, Eczema etc.
-a strong decoction as a wash stops all types of Itching
-Chronic and Hard-to-heal Sores and Ulcers including Old, Foul or Varicose Ulcers
-‘all malignant and Leprous running and filthy Ulcers’ (Dioscorides)
-Tumors and Cancers, including those of the breast
-stops Pain of the Teeth

Cautions:
Generally Safe. Use cautiously in cold and weakness of the digestion

Main Preparations used:
Dehydrated Juice, Distilled Water of the whole Plant, Syrup of the Juice
